How To Style A Fringe Skirt

Pairing it with a low-cut bodysuit elevated the skirt to happy hour status. After the get together, we “stumbled” upon a few rum punches and enjoyed the stunning Barbadian sunset.

My mom loved this Sympli skirt so much but wondered what else I could wear it with. I told her that so far, I paired it with a loose chambray shirt, a basic white t-shirt half tucked in at the waist and it looked awesome with a boyfriend blazer that I scored on sale.
